St John's Lough (eastern entrance)
R208, Ballinamore ED, County Leitrim, Ireland

St John's Lough (eastern entrance)
is a minor waterways place
on the Shannon - Erne Waterway between
Shannon - Shannon-Erne Junction (Junction of the River Shannon with the Shannon-Erne Waterway) (10 miles and 7½ furlongs
and 9 locks
to the west) and
Drummard Lough (northern entrance) (Access to River Erne at Bunanumery) (27 miles and 2 furlongs
and 7 locks
to the east).
The nearest place in the direction of Shannon - Shannon-Erne Junction is Tomloskan Bridge;
2¾ furlongs
away.
The nearest place in the direction of Drummard Lough (northern entrance) is Bridge (west of Ballyduff Lock);
2¾ furlongs
away.
